CONNECTICUT: FALL GALA with presentation of Humanitarian Award to Mary Tyler Moore
Where: Westport, Conn. (The Inn at Longshore)
Date: Friday, November 16
Benefitting: Connecticut Humane Society
Information: For more information visit the Connecticut Humane Society event page.
Can’t make the event? Make a donation to support the Connecticut Humane Society.
Image courtesy of the Connecticut Humane Society
This travel themed black tie optional event will feature performances from Broadway stars, exciting silent and live auctions, a reception, dinner, and the presentation of the first Gertrude O. Lewis Humanitarian Award to Mary Tyler Moore.
Mary Tyler Moore, a Greenwich, Conn. resident and renowned actress, founded Broadway Barks fourteen years ago with Broadway legend, Bernadette Peters. Every year, this star-studded annual pet adoption event finds homes for hundreds of companion animals from New York area shelters.
Gertrude O. Lewis founded the Connecticut Humane Society as a Hartford High School Senior in 1881. Our Humanitarian Award in her name will be presented annually to individuals and organizations making a difference in the lives of homeless pets or in the field of animal welfare.
Performing at the Gala will be Kristin Huffman, Artistic Director of New Paradigm Theatre, and fellow Broadway performers. Kristin appeared in the Tony award winning and Grammy nominated revival of Stephen Sondheim’s “Company,” in which she played a leading role (Sarah) as well as flute, sax and piccolo.
